The Kii Factory is 1 of 3 mills owned and operated by the Rungeto Farmers Cooperative Society, alongside Kiangoi and Karimikui. Established in 1953, the cooperative supports thousands of producers farming small plots of around 1 hectare at 1700-1900 masl, where coffee is typically grown alongside crops for household use. Around 850 of these smallholders contribute cherry to the Kii Factory, located in Embu, Kirinyaga, on the fertile slopes of Mount Kenya. Its namesake, the nearby Kii river, provides water for the community and for coffee processing.

During harvest, handpicked cherries are delivered to the Kii Factory. Here they are pulped and graded by density in water, and then fermented, washed, and cleaned to remove any remaining mucilage. The parchment is then soaked in clean water before being transferred to raised drying tables. Drying begins in thin, even layers to remove surface moisture, before careful turning and monitoring over several days until the desired moisture content is reached. This lot is graded as AA, referring to the larger bean size selection that Kenya is known for, often associated with clarity and striking cup structure. Kirinyaga has become one of Kenya’s most recognised coffee-producing regions, known for its disciplined processing methods and strong cooperative networks. Factories like Kii play a central role in maintaining quality, and we have been buying their vibrant, unmistakable coffees since 2018.

About this coffee

Taste
Blackcurrant, Orange Blossom, Golden Syrup
Origin
Kenya
Region
Kirinyaga
Varietal
SL28, SL34, Ruiru-11
Process
Washed
Altitude
1700 - 1900 masl
